He leaves sons, Albinas S. and Ernest J. Young, both of Hagerstown; six grandchildren; sisters, Mrs. Tina Eleker and Mrs. Mildred Lougerman, both of Pittsburgh; brothers, Ralph, Ernest, and Howard, all of Pittsburgh; and half-brothers, William Richard, Francis Raymond, all of Pittsburgh.
Services were held at A.K. Coffman Funeral Home; burial was in Rose Hill Cemetery.
Source: Morning Herald (Hagerstown, MD)
Friday, January 22, 1965, Page 24*
